Windows系统虚拟IP地址配置及应用详解380
Windows系统支持多种网络配置方式,其中虚拟IP地址(Virtual IP Address, VIP)技术允许一台物理主机拥有多个IP地址,这在服务器集群、负载均衡、网络隔离等场景中具有重要的应用价值。本文将深入探讨Windows系统下虚拟IP地址的配置方法、工作原理以及在不同应用场景下的实践技巧,并分析其优缺点。
一、虚拟IP地址的工作原理
在Windows系统中,虚拟IP地址并非真正意义上的物理接口IP地址,而是通过软件层面的虚拟化技术实现的。主要依靠路由和网络接口虚拟化技术来实现。它与物理网卡绑定,但并非直接分配给物理网卡,而是通过特定的网络协议栈和软件驱动程序,将虚拟IP地址与物理网卡进行关联。当数据包到达虚拟IP地址时,系统根据预先配置的路由规则,将数据包转发到正确的物理网络接口或应用程序。
常用的实现虚拟IP地址的方法包括:使用虚拟网络适配器(例如Hyper-V虚拟交换机)、使用第三方虚拟IP软件以及利用路由和远程访问服务(RRAS)中的多宿主配置。
二、虚拟IP地址的配置方法
1. 使用Hyper-V虚拟交换机: 这是在Windows Server系统中实现虚拟IP地址的一种常见方法。通过创建虚拟交换机,并为虚拟机分配虚拟IP地址,实现虚拟IP的网络隔离和管理。这需要先启用Hyper-V角色,然后创建虚拟交换机,最后在虚拟机的网络配置中设置虚拟IP地址。
2. 使用第三方虚拟IP软件: 市场上有多种虚拟IP软件可供选择,这些软件通常提供更便捷的虚拟IP地址管理界面,例如可以轻松添加、删除和管理多个虚拟IP地址。这类软件通常会安装一个虚拟网卡驱动,并在系统中创建一个虚拟网络接口,然后将虚拟IP地址绑定到该接口。
3. 使用RRAS中的多宿主配置: 在Windows Server系统中,路由和远程访问服务(RRAS)可以配置多宿主模式,允许一台服务器拥有多个IP地址。这需要先安装和配置RRAS服务,然后在网络接口配置中添加虚拟IP地址。这种方法通常用于构建路由器、VPN服务器或负载均衡器。
无论采用哪种方法,配置虚拟IP地址时都需要确保:虚拟IP地址未被网络中的其他设备使用;子网掩码与物理网卡的子网掩码一致;默认网关设置正确;DNS服务器设置正确。
三、虚拟IP地址的应用场景
1. 负载均衡: 通过将多个虚拟IP地址绑定到不同的服务器,可以实现负载均衡。当请求到达虚拟IP地址时,负载均衡器会根据预先设定的算法将请求分发到不同的服务器,提高系统的可用性和处理能力。
2. 服务器集群: 在服务器集群中,可以使用虚拟IP地址作为集群的公共访问点。当一台服务器出现故障时,可以将虚拟IP地址切换到另一台正常的服务器,保证服务的连续性。
3. 网络隔离: 通过在不同的网络接口上配置不同的虚拟IP地址,可以实现网络隔离,增强网络安全性。
4. VPN服务器: VPN服务器可以配置多个虚拟IP地址,为不同的用户或用户组提供独立的访问点。
5. 多个网站托管: 一台服务器可以通过配置多个虚拟IP地址,分别托管多个不同的网站,节省服务器资源。
四、虚拟IP地址的优缺点
优点:
提高资源利用率:一台服务器可以拥有多个IP地址,提供更多的网络服务。
增强网络安全性:通过网络隔离技术,提高网络安全性。
简化网络管理:集中管理多个虚拟IP地址。
提高系统可用性:通过负载均衡和服务器集群技术,提高系统可用性。
缺点:
配置复杂:配置虚拟IP地址需要一定的网络知识和技能。
潜在的冲突:如果虚拟IP地址与其他设备的IP地址冲突,可能会导致网络故障。
软件依赖:一些虚拟IP地址的实现依赖于特定的软件或驱动程序。
五、安全考虑
在使用虚拟IP地址时,需要注意安全问题。例如,需要定期检查虚拟IP地址的配置,确保其正确性和安全性。同时,还需要采取其他安全措施,例如防火墙、入侵检测系统等,以保护服务器的安全。
总之,Windows系统虚拟IP地址技术在网络管理和应用部署中扮演着重要的角色。理解其工作原理、配置方法以及应用场景,可以更好地利用这项技术提高网络效率和安全性。 选择合适的虚拟IP地址配置方法需要根据具体需求和系统环境进行权衡。
2025-05-23
新文章

鸿蒙OS流畅体验背后的操作系统技术深度解析

电商iOS系统深度解析:架构、性能优化与安全防护

iOS闹钟铃声系统深度解析:从内核到用户体验

Android 10 系统安装程序:深入剖析其架构与工作机制

鸿蒙OS:华为自主研发的分布式操作系统深度解析

iOS降级:风险、方法及底层机制详解

Android系统开机时间优化:深度剖析与关键技术

Android系统、固件与内核:深入剖析其区别与联系

华为鸿蒙系统迁移与操作系统内核移植技术详解

Android系统架构详解:深入剖析其五层结构
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
